knit 16 inch diamond /square for blankets/ sweaters etc--(Square on point)

Posted on August 27, 2009 at 8:30am 4 Comments

red heart yarn size 9 needles (in garter stitch-knit every row)



Cast on 3 sts

knit first row



Begin increase rows

Row 1 - knit into front & back of first & last stitches - 5 sts now (WS)

Row 2 - Knit across row (RS)



Repeat these 2 rows



Until you have 91 sts (for a 16 inch square) you will always have an uneven # of stitches



( # of sts determine size of square)
